Regular Inspection and Pumping

Typically, a home sewage tank needs to be professionally examined at least every 3 to 5 years by experienced technicians. During this inspection, the professional examiners will check for seepage, inspect both the upper and lower sections of your waste tank, analyze the scum and sludge layers in your sewage tank, and execute skilled pumping of your waste tank.

Efficient Use Of Water

Minimizing water usage in a residence equates to reduced water going into the sewage system. Restroom flushing habits accounts for about 25% to 30% of water consumption in the household. An optimal method to decrease water usage in the restroom involves replacing older fixtures with high-efficiency fixtures, employing less gallons of water per flushing.

High Efficiency Shower Heads

Water used when bathing is also directed into the sewage system. To decrease this, the smart choice is to utilize high-efficiency shower appliances, crafted to lower water consumption.

Proper Disposal of Waste

Many people possess the unfortunate practice of dealing with the bathroom as if it were a waste receptacle. Nonetheless, engaging in this behavior ultimately results in sewage system obstructions. So, householders must ensure that everyone in the household gets rid of refuse appropriately and avoids it down the toilet.

Types Of Septic Tank Systems Available

During the process of installing a septic tank, skilled technicians take multiple factors into thought, including which include the scale of the property, weather patterns, climatic conditions of the location, soil type, and so forth.

All of these aspects play a role in choosing the appropriate type of sewage tank system for installation. Below are numerous varieties of sewage tank systems ready for installation at DJ Plumbing Septic Tank Services:

Conventional Tank System

Also known as a gravity-fed septic system, this kind of septic system is both the most prevalent and the simplest to set up and keep in good condition. This particular sewage tank system doesn't need any extra complex electrical or technological elements. In contrast, it relies exclusively on the force of gravity.

Chamber Septic Tank System

The chamber septic tank system, features chambered drains usually crafted from plastic, specifically high-density polyethylene. However,, it's worth noting that different materials can also be used for these chambers.

Over the past 30-year period, this particular type of septic tank system has gained considerable recognition, largely because of its economical installation and ease of installation. Caring for it follows a similar process to the conventional a standard septic tank system.

Mound Septic Tank System

This particular sewage tank system is utilized for buildings situated on shallow soil or adjacent to surface bedrock. The installation of this tank system involves forming a constructed mound consisting of distinct levels of soil, gravel, and sand as the drainfield.

In contrast to standard sewage tank system, this type of sewage tank system uses electrical energy, and it also requires periodic maintenance and examinations, in contrast to the typical sewage tank system, which happens to be considerably more straightforward to maintain.

Aerobic Treatment Unit

Referred to as Aerobic Treatment Units (ATUs), this specific sewage tank system makes use of an electric pump for pumping oxygen into the septic tank. The presence of oxygen allows oxygen-loving microorganisms to flourish within the septic tank. This process results in the biodegradation of waste materials contained within the septic tank.

Typically, this type of sewage tank is constructed in locations near surface aquatic environments or where there are unfavorable soil conditions. It's important to note that maintaining this type of sewage tank system can be quite expensive, because it requires continuous maintenance treatments.

Recirculating Sand Filter Septic Tank System

This particular sewage tank system makes use of a layer of sand fill for the treatment and recirculation of wastewater. To function effectively, this system needs the installation of electricity. As opposed to various sewage tanks, the installation and maintenance of this system tends to be relatively expensive.

Conehatta is a census-designated place (CDP) in Newton County, Mississippi. The population was 997 at the 2000 census. It is one of the eight communities included in the Mississippi Band of Choctaw Indians Reservation and the population is 76% Choctaw.
